 
        
        Developing Mobile Applications for Video Streaming Platforms
We are seeking a seasoned software engineer to collaborate on the development of mobile applications for video streaming services.
Key Responsibilities:
Implement new features and enhance existing functionalities in client applications to support video streaming products. This involves estimation, design, development, testing, and documentation.
Create effective solutions in collaboration with other software engineers, product managers, and architects in an agile environment to meet customer requirements efficiently and maintainably.
Provide technical support including issue identification, analysis, and resolution in production environments.
Mandatory Skills and Qualifications:
- Proficiency in JavaScript and React Native mobile app development (5+ years) as well as at least one of the following: Java/Kotlin or Obj-C/Swift
- Experience in developing mobile applications for video streaming services using iOS/Android and TV platforms
- Strong team player focus with excellent communication skills
- Agile development methodologies experience
- Good written and verbal communication skills
Nice-to-Have Skills:
- Experience with continuous integration and delivery environments
Languages:
English: Upper Intermediate